説明

In this insightful work, educators are guided through a thoughtful exploration of teaching and learning in social studies. The authors present a coherent framework that encourages a powerful and engaging approach, blending practical strategies with theoretical foundations. They emphasize the importance of constructing knowledge in the classroom, fostering an environment where students become active participants in their learning journey.

The narrative unfolds by addressing key concepts that redefine the role of social studies in the educational landscape. Through a series of practical applications, the authors illustrate how to effectively engage students with content that resonates with their lives and the world around them. This approach not only enhances critical thinking but also cultivates a sense of civic responsibility among learners.

As the discussion progresses, the emphasis on inquiry-based learning becomes evident, guiding teachers to create meaningful experiences that inspire curiosity. By implementing these strategies, educators can transform their classrooms into dynamic spaces where students are encouraged to ask questions, explore diverse perspectives, and develop a deep understanding of societal issues.

Ultimately, this work serves as a valuable resource for educators seeking to revitalize their social studies curriculum. It challenges traditional methods and advocates for a more meaningful, engaging approach to teaching that prepares students for active citizenship and lifelong learning.
